ABOUT GOODR

We create and sell active eyewear for anyone. No Slip. No Bounce. All Polarized. All Fun. Interested in joining our team? Keep reading.

OUR VALUES: We have two core values: Fun & Authenticity.

  • FUN = Being sh*tty isn't fun. Agreed? Taking pride in your work, finding joy in being GREAT, and celebrating wins… and losses. Now, that's fun!
  • AUTHENTICITY = Focusing on being authentic over being liked. (Next-level guru stuff. Count it.)

Fun Fact: We do not allow email to be sent internally. Carrier pigeons only. JK, we use Slack.

SUSTAINABILITY: We think Earth's pretty rad. That's why we take action wherever possible to limit our impact on the planet.

  • 1% FOR THE PLANET MEMBER: 1% of goodr's annual sales go directly to environmental organizations.
  • CARBON NEUTRAL: In 2019, goodr became a 100% carbon neutral company.

Fun Fact: goodr celebrates every Earth Day by releasing limited-edition sunglasses with frames made from 100% recycled materials—and the packaging is 100% sustainable, too!


ABOUT THE ROLE

Ever wonder how a pair of sunglasses gets made… or how a wild idea like pink furry frames becomes actual reality? Maybe you're curious how in the world a company lets a flamingo named Carl run the place. Well, look no further! goodr is calling all flaminglets — yes, that's a baby flamingo — for our 2026 Summer Internship Program!

At goodr, we show up unabashedly ourselves, own our sh**t, and get things done. And we want our interns to do the same. Join us for a 10-week adventure from June 15th, 2026 - August 21st, 2026. Did someone say bragging rights? OH YES WE DID. This full-time, paid internship gives you real-world experience, flamingo-level fun, and skills you can take into any future career.

As our Creative Strategy Intern, you'll help turn big ideas into campaigns that inspire and engage.You'll assist with trend research, performance analysis, and digital asset management, while adding your unique perspective to brainstorms. Challenge the status quo, spark new ideas, and contribute to creative solutions that keep our brand ahead of the curve. If you love researching, testing, and shaping what's next, this role is for you!


R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Gain hands-on experience bridging creative and marketing strategy in a fast-paced sports eyewear environment
  • Develop data-driven creative strategies to reach, engage, and convert audiences into purchasers
  • Translate business objectives into impactful campaign ideas
  • Conduct market research and competitor analysis to inform performance media strategies
  • Analyze video and digital content performance to support optimizations
  • Manage digital assets to ensure brand consistency and accuracy
  • Collaborate with designers, copywriters, marketing, and sales teams to execute campaigns
  • Monitor campaign analytics and optimize for engagement and results
  • Report campaign performance to key role holders
  • Advocate for consistent brand voice across channels while balancing creativity and performance
  • Support the creative process from brainstorming through execution
  • Contribute ideas and assist on projects that impact the brand
  • Conduct strategic research, including cultural scans, competitive audits, and trend case studies
  • Manage multiple campaigns and projects simultaneously
  • This role is in the Creative Strategy team and will report directly to the Creative Strategy Manager
  • Perform other related duties as assigned

INTERNSHIP REQUIREMENTS

  • Available to work full-time: 40 hours per week, Monday-Friday, 9am-5pm
  • Committed to the full 10-week internship: June 15, 2026 - August 21, 2026
  • Able to work onsite at our Inglewood, CA office
  • Must reside in Los Angeles or the surrounding area for the duration of the internship
  • Fully onsite for the first 30 days to help us get to know you in person
  • After the first 30 days, onsite every Tuesday and Thursday
  • No college degree or prior experience needed—just a passion for learning and jumping into the flamingo-filled chaos of goodr
